Kingswood: Wayfinding & Educational Signage

A directional arrow sign on a wooded trail.
The Township is undertaking a project to add wayfinding and educational signage at Kingswood Park.

What is the project timeline?
  • This is Phase II of the Kingswood Pathway Project. (In Phase 1, pathway connections were completed.)
  • Phase II: Providing wayfinding (trail naming/identification) and educational signage. Signage providing educational topics related to prairie ecosystems was added to the project in late 2021.
  • Educational signage was installed in March 2022.
  • Anticipated completion of wayfinding signage is Summer of 2023.

Where exactly will this project take place?
  • Wayfinding will be completed on trails for both the south and the north side of the park.
  • Educational signage will be added on the north side of the park.

How is the project funded?
  • This project is being funded through the Deerfield Township Park Levy.

What is the benefit of this project to the community?
  • Wayfinding improves accessibility and clearly defines trails.
  • Educational signage increases community awareness and knowledge of prairie ecosystems.
